About Osleston
Osleston is a small village located in Derbyshire, England, within the DE6 postcode area. The village features a mix of traditional stone houses and modern residences, reflecting its development over the years. Osleston is surrounded by the rolling hills and countryside typical of the region, making it a pleasant area for those who enjoy outdoor activities such as walking and cycling.
The village is served by a local church, which is a focal point for community gatherings. Osleston's proximity to larger towns and cities in Derbyshire provides residents and visitors with access to a wider range of amenities and services. The area is well-connected by road, making it easy to explore the surrounding countryside and nearby attractions.

Household Income in Osleston ONS 2023
The average total household income in Osleston is approximately £56,633 a year before tax, in line with the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£45,729.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Osleston ONS 2025
There are approximately 1,886 active businesses based in Osleston, around 81 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 92%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 28 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Osleston
Of the 10,005 households in and around Osleston, 73% are owned, 11% are socially rented and 16%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Osleston.
